Dear Visitors,
Welcome to the website of The York Union, the debating society at the University of York! We act as a non-partisan forum for free discussion and debate on any, and every, matter. We do not shy away from the controversial, quite the opposite. We believe in hearing and debating all views- the passive, the aggressive, the moderate, the extreme and the confused are all welcome through our doors. We want to develop our understanding of the world around us and the people in it. From international affairs to questions of morality (and of course the occasional debate on cheese), we offer both complex and comical discussion.

As one of the most active societies on campus, we have a wide range of activities on offer to our members from weekly debates and debating training classes, competing in national Inter-Varsity competitions almost every weekend, hosting high-profile speakers to address the Union, running our own annual Inter-Varsity competition and Schools Competition and going on trips, we have a packed termcard for our members.

And then there are the socials! Any excuse seems to be the policy here, with movie nights, trips to comedy shows/plays, three-legged bar crawls, giant picnics in the summer and the annual ball after the York IV.

Debates: Weekly Debates
We hold a debate every TUESDAY, at 20:00 in L/N/002, see 'Coming Up' for this week's motion. Come along to vote on and watch our lively debates - its free! If you would like to be reminded of these debates and the upcoming motion, please join our mailing list by emailing socs584@york.ac.uk

Training: Debating Training and Practice
Classes are held for Beginners and Advanced debaters once a week. The Beginners and Advanced classes are both held at 18:30 in L/N/002 each Tuesday,and are followed by the public debate at 20:00. Classes are free for members but are charged at £2/class for non-members bar the first class of each term. For more information, email socs584@york.ac.uk.
